A private ADHD assessment includes a clinical interview with psychiatrist. During the interview, a psychiatrist will inquire about your past experiences and how ADHD symptoms impact your daily life. They will also ask you to rule out any other mental health issues, such as anxiety or depression. Tell your psychiatrist if you have an history of mental illness in your family.

The time required to complete an ADHD assessment can vary depending on the severity of your symptoms. A thorough ADHD assessment can take up to three hours. The psychiatrist will examine your symptoms and speak with family and friends. They will then write a report and send it to you for review.

You should also bring any relevant documentation, including school reports to your appointment. This is crucial because the psychiatrist will need to determine if you've been exhibiting symptoms since your childhood.
